自動(dòng)化軟件接收測(cè)試裝置及其測(cè)試方法
【專利摘要】本發(fā)明公開了一種自動(dòng)化軟件接收測(cè)試裝置,包含:顯示模塊,用于輸出測(cè)試過程日志信息及反饋測(cè)試結(jié)果;與顯示模塊連接的信息讀取模塊,用于讀取電子設(shè)備的軟件版本信息及型號(hào)信息;與顯示模塊連接的硬件檢測(cè)模塊,用于檢測(cè)電子設(shè)備的硬件是否完備;與顯示模塊連接的配置信息檢測(cè)模塊,用于讀取配置信息;與信息讀取模塊連接的軟件升級(jí)模塊,用于升級(jí)電子設(shè)備的軟件版本;與配置信息檢測(cè)模塊連接的配置模塊,用于設(shè)置測(cè)試內(nèi)容。本發(fā)明還公開了一種測(cè)試方法。本發(fā)明將接收測(cè)試自動(dòng)化可縮短驗(yàn)收過程,迅速便捷地獲得測(cè)試結(jié)果,減少軟件重復(fù)發(fā)布版本次數(shù),降低測(cè)試的人員投入,提高測(cè)試效率。
【專利說明】自動(dòng)化軟件接收測(cè)試裝置及其測(cè)試方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及通信設(shè)備軟件輸入的測(cè)試方法,具體涉及自動(dòng)化軟件接收測(cè)試裝置及其測(cè)試方法。
【背景技術(shù)】
[0002]隨著產(chǎn)品開發(fā)周期的縮短,測(cè)試工作量的相對(duì)增加,為在保證產(chǎn)品質(zhì)量的前提下減少軟件重復(fù)發(fā)布版本次數(shù),在進(jìn)行軟件完整功能測(cè)試前對(duì)待測(cè)軟件進(jìn)行接收測(cè)試十分必要。
[0003]現(xiàn)有技術(shù)中軟件接收測(cè)試,以手工測(cè)試為主,進(jìn)行基本功能測(cè)試,難免會(huì)有疏忽,如LED燈狀態(tài)偏差,造成軟件接收測(cè)試漏洞,耗費(fèi)人力并且需要花費(fèi)較長(zhǎng)時(shí)間和精力去升級(jí)軟件,驗(yàn)收是否滿足輸入測(cè)試條件,測(cè)試進(jìn)度有一定的延遲。
【發(fā)明內(nèi)容】
[0004]本發(fā)明的目的在于提供一種自動(dòng)化軟件接收測(cè)試裝置及其測(cè)試方法,將接收測(cè)試自動(dòng)化可縮短驗(yàn)收過程,迅速便捷地獲得測(cè)試結(jié)果,減少軟件重復(fù)發(fā)布版本次數(shù),降低測(cè)試的人員投入,提高測(cè)試效率。
[0005]為了達(dá)到上述目的,本發(fā)明通過以下技術(shù)方案實(shí)現(xiàn):一種自動(dòng)化軟件接收測(cè)試裝置,其特點(diǎn)是,包含:
顯示模塊,用于輸出測(cè)試過程日志信息及反饋測(cè)試結(jié)果;
與顯示模塊連接的信息讀取模塊,用于讀取電子設(shè)備的軟件版本信息及型號(hào)信息; 與顯示模塊連接的硬件檢測(cè)模塊,用于檢測(cè)電子設(shè)備的硬件是否完備;
與顯示模塊連接的配置信息檢測(cè)模塊,用于讀取配置信息;
與信息讀取模塊連接的軟件升級(jí)模塊,用于升級(jí)電子設(shè)備的軟件版本;
與配置信息檢測(cè)模塊連接的配置模塊,用于設(shè)置測(cè)試內(nèi)容。
[0006]所述的電子設(shè)備為無線AP設(shè)備、路由器、交換機(jī)、家庭網(wǎng)關(guān)、ADSL用戶端設(shè)備。
[0007]—種用于上述自動(dòng)化軟件接收測(cè)試裝置的測(cè)試方法,其特點(diǎn)是,包含以下步驟: 步驟1、信息讀取模塊讀取電子設(shè)備的初始軟件版本信息及型號(hào)信息,并將電子設(shè)備的
軟件版本信息及型號(hào)信息發(fā)送至顯示模塊;
步驟2、軟件升級(jí)模塊升級(jí)電子設(shè)備的軟件版本;
步驟3、信息讀取模塊讀取升級(jí)后的電子設(shè)備的當(dāng)前軟件版本信息并判斷當(dāng)前軟件版本信息與初始軟件版本信息是否相同;
步驟S1、若當(dāng)前軟件版本信息與初始軟件版本信息相同,則返回步驟2 ;
步驟S2、若當(dāng)前軟件版本信息與初始軟件版本信息不同,則硬件檢測(cè)模塊檢測(cè)電子設(shè)備的硬件信息,并將電子設(shè)備的硬件信息發(fā)送至顯示模塊;
所述的步驟S2進(jìn)一步包含以下步驟;
a、配置模塊設(shè)置測(cè)試內(nèi)容; b、配置信息檢測(cè)模塊讀取配置信息并將配置信息發(fā)送至顯示模塊;
C、配置模塊及配置信息檢測(cè)模塊共同得出測(cè)試結(jié)論并將測(cè)試結(jié)論發(fā)送至顯示模塊。
[0008]所述的步驟2中升級(jí)軟件版本完成后需對(duì)電子設(shè)備重啟。
[0009]所述的測(cè)試內(nèi)容包含軟件升級(jí)、LED燈檢測(cè)、快速向?qū)暇W(wǎng)配置、快速向?qū)o線功能配置、設(shè)備恢復(fù)出廠值、導(dǎo)入配置及導(dǎo)出配置。
[0010]所述的步驟S2中若電子設(shè)備的硬件信息不完備則結(jié)束自動(dòng)化軟件接收測(cè)試。
[0011]所述的步驟b中的讀取配置信息包含讀取撥號(hào)信息、無線名稱、無線密碼信息、設(shè)備配置導(dǎo)入信息、設(shè)備初始信息。
[0012]所述的步驟c中的測(cè)試結(jié)論包含軟件升級(jí)成功、LED燈顯示正常、快速向?qū)暇W(wǎng)配置正常保存、快速向?qū)o線配置正常保存、電子設(shè)備正常上網(wǎng)。
[0013]本發(fā)明一種自動(dòng)化軟件接收測(cè)試裝置及其測(cè)試方法與現(xiàn)有技術(shù)相比具有以下優(yōu)點(diǎn):簡(jiǎn)化手工測(cè)試裝置的配置,部分配置測(cè)試工具自動(dòng)完成配置;測(cè)試過程無需人員投入,測(cè)試裝置自動(dòng)運(yùn)行,迅速便捷地獲得測(cè)試結(jié)果,減少軟件重復(fù)發(fā)布版本次數(shù),實(shí)時(shí)輸出測(cè)試日志,降低測(cè)試的人員投入,提高測(cè)試效率;避免人工測(cè)試造成的疏忽,避免造成軟件接收測(cè)試漏洞。
【專利附圖】
【附圖說明】
[0014]圖1為本發(fā)明一種自動(dòng)化軟件接收測(cè)試裝置的整體結(jié)構(gòu)示意圖。
[0015]圖2為本發(fā)明一種自動(dòng)化軟件接收測(cè)試方法的流程圖。
【具體實(shí)施方式】
[0016]以下結(jié)合附圖,通過詳細(xì)說明一個(gè)較佳的具體實(shí)施例,對(duì)本發(fā)明做進(jìn)一步闡述。
[0017]如圖1所示,一種自動(dòng)化軟件接收測(cè)試裝置,包含:顯示模塊1,用于輸出測(cè)試過程日志信息及反饋測(cè)試結(jié)果,便于測(cè)試員直觀看到測(cè)試進(jìn)程;與顯示模塊I連接的信息讀取模塊2,用于讀取電子設(shè)備的軟件版本信息及型號(hào)信息;與顯示模塊I連接的硬件檢測(cè)模塊3,用于檢測(cè)電子設(shè)備的硬件是否完備;與顯示模塊I連接的配置信息檢測(cè)模塊4,用于讀取配置信息;與信息讀取模塊2連接的軟件升級(jí)模塊5,用于升級(jí)電子設(shè)備的軟件版本;與配置信息檢測(cè)模塊4連接的配置模塊6,用于設(shè)置測(cè)試內(nèi)容,節(jié)省重復(fù)配置時(shí)間。電子設(shè)備為無線AP設(shè)備。
[0018]如圖2所示,一種自動(dòng)化軟件接收測(cè)試裝置的測(cè)試方法,包含以下步驟:
步驟1、信息讀取模塊2讀取電子設(shè)備的初始軟件版本信息及型號(hào)信息,并將電子設(shè)備的軟件版本信息及型號(hào)信息發(fā)送至顯示模塊I ;
步驟2、軟件升級(jí)模塊5升級(jí)電子設(shè)備的軟件版本;
步驟3、信息讀取模塊2讀取升級(jí)后的電子設(shè)備的當(dāng)前軟件版本信息并判斷當(dāng)前軟件版本信息與初始軟件版本信息是否相同;
步驟S1、若當(dāng)前軟件版本信息與初始軟件版本信息相同,則返回步驟2 ;
步驟S2、若當(dāng)前軟件版本信息與初始軟件版本信息不同,則硬件檢測(cè)模塊3檢測(cè)電子設(shè)備的硬件信息是否完備,若電子設(shè)備的硬件信息不完備則結(jié)束自動(dòng)化軟件接收測(cè)試,若電子設(shè)備的硬件信息完備則將電子設(shè)備的硬件信息發(fā)送至顯示模塊I ; 所述的步驟S2進(jìn)一步包含以下步驟;
a、配置模塊6設(shè)置測(cè)試內(nèi)容包含軟件升級(jí)、LED燈檢測(cè)、快速向?qū)暇W(wǎng)配置、快速向?qū)o線功能配置、設(shè)備恢復(fù)出廠值、導(dǎo)入配置及導(dǎo)出配置;
b、配置信息檢測(cè)模塊4讀取配置信息(撥號(hào)信息、無線名稱、無線密碼信息、設(shè)備配置導(dǎo)入信息、設(shè)備初始信息)并將配置信息發(fā)送至顯示模塊I ;
C、配置模塊6及配置信息檢測(cè)模塊4共同得出測(cè)試結(jié)論(軟件升級(jí)成功、LED燈顯示正常、快速向?qū)暇W(wǎng)配置正常保存、快速向?qū)o線配置正常保存、電子設(shè)備正常上網(wǎng))并將測(cè)試結(jié)論發(fā)送至顯示模塊。步驟2中升級(jí)軟件版本完成后需對(duì)電子設(shè)備重啟。
[0019]具體應(yīng)用:一種自動(dòng)化軟件接收測(cè)試裝置的測(cè)試方法,用于包含但不限于無線AP設(shè)備、路由器、交換機(jī)、家庭網(wǎng)關(guān)、ADSL用戶端設(shè)備,以無線AP設(shè)備為例,包含以下步驟:
步驟1、信息讀取模塊2讀取無線AP設(shè)備的初始軟件版本信息及型號(hào)信息,并將無線AP設(shè)備的軟件版本信息及型號(hào)信息發(fā)送至顯示模塊I ;
步驟2、軟件升級(jí)模塊5升級(jí)無線AP設(shè)備的軟件版本,完成后重啟無線AP設(shè)備;
步驟3、信息讀取模塊2讀取升級(jí)后的無線AP設(shè)備的當(dāng)前軟件版本信息并判斷當(dāng)前軟件版本信息與初始軟件版本信息是否相同;
步驟S1、若當(dāng)前軟件版本信息與初始軟件版本信息不同,則返回步驟2 ;
步驟S2、若當(dāng)前軟件版本信息與初始軟件版本信息相同,則硬件檢測(cè)模塊3檢測(cè)無線AP設(shè)備的硬件信息是否完備,若無線AP設(shè)備的硬件信息不完備則結(jié)束自動(dòng)化軟件接收測(cè)試,若無線AP設(shè)備的硬件信息完備則將無線AP設(shè)備的硬件信息發(fā)送至顯示模塊I ;
所述的步驟S2進(jìn)一步包含以下步驟;
a、配置模塊6設(shè)置測(cè)試內(nèi)容包含軟件升級(jí)、LED燈檢測(cè)、快速向?qū)暇W(wǎng)配置、快速向?qū)o線功能配置、設(shè)備恢復(fù)出廠值、導(dǎo)入配置及導(dǎo)出配置;
b、配置信息檢測(cè)模塊4讀取配置信息(撥號(hào)信息、無線名稱、無線密碼信息、設(shè)備配置導(dǎo)入信息、設(shè)備初始信息)并將配置信息發(fā)送至顯示模塊I ;
C、配置模塊6及配置信息檢測(cè)模塊4共同得出測(cè)試結(jié)論(軟件升級(jí)成功、LED燈顯示正常、快速向?qū)暇W(wǎng)配置正常保存、快速向?qū)o線配置正常保存、電子設(shè)備正常上網(wǎng))并將測(cè)試結(jié)論發(fā)送至顯示模塊。
[0020]盡管本發(fā)明的內(nèi)容已經(jīng)通過上述優(yōu)選實(shí)施例作了詳細(xì)介紹,但應(yīng)當(dāng)認(rèn)識(shí)到上述的描述不應(yīng)被認(rèn)為是對(duì)本發(fā)明的限制。在本領(lǐng)域技術(shù)人員閱讀了上述內(nèi)容后,對(duì)于本發(fā)明的多種修改和替代都將是顯而易見的。因此,本發(fā)明的保護(hù)范圍應(yīng)由所附的權(quán)利要求來限定。
【權(quán)利要求】
1.一種自動(dòng)化軟件接收測(cè)試裝置,其特征在于,包含: 顯示模塊(I),用于輸出測(cè)試過程日志信息及反饋測(cè)試結(jié)果; 與顯示模塊(I)連接的信息讀取模塊(2),用于讀取電子設(shè)備的軟件版本信息及型號(hào)信息; 與顯示模塊(I)連接的硬件檢測(cè)模塊(3),用于檢測(cè)電子設(shè)備的硬件是否完備; 與顯示模塊(I)連接的配置信息檢測(cè)模塊(4),用于讀取配置信息; 與信息讀取模塊(2)連接的軟件升級(jí)模塊(5),用于升級(jí)電子設(shè)備的軟件版本; 與配置信息檢測(cè)模塊(4)連接的配置模塊(6),用于設(shè)置測(cè)試內(nèi)容。
2.如權(quán)利要求1所述的自動(dòng)化軟件接收測(cè)試裝置,其特征在于,所述的電子設(shè)備為無線AP設(shè)備、路由器、交換機(jī)、家庭網(wǎng)關(guān)、ADSL用戶端設(shè)備。
3.一種用于上述自動(dòng)化軟件接收測(cè)試裝置的測(cè)試方法,其特征在于,包含以下步驟: 步驟1、信息讀取模塊(2)讀取電子設(shè)備的初始軟件版本信息及型號(hào)信息,并將電子設(shè)備的軟件版本信息及型號(hào)信息發(fā)送至顯示模塊(I); 步驟2、軟件升級(jí)模塊(5)升級(jí)電子設(shè)備的軟件版本; 步驟3、信息讀取模塊(2)讀取升級(jí)后的電子設(shè)備的當(dāng)前軟件版本信息并判斷當(dāng)前軟件版本信息與初始軟件版本信息是否相同; 步驟S1、若當(dāng)前軟件版本信息與初始軟件版本信息相同,則返回步驟2 ; 步驟S2、若當(dāng)前軟件版本信息與初始軟件版本信息不同,則硬件檢測(cè)模塊(3)檢測(cè)電子設(shè)備的硬件信息,并將電子設(shè)備的硬件信息發(fā)送至顯示模塊(I); 所述的步驟S2進(jìn)一步包含以下步驟; a、配置模塊(6)設(shè)置測(cè)試內(nèi)容; b、配置信息檢測(cè)模塊(4)讀取配置信息并將配置信息發(fā)送至顯示模塊(I); C、配置模塊(6)及配置信息檢測(cè)模塊(4)共同得出測(cè)試結(jié)論并將測(cè)試結(jié)論發(fā)送至顯示模塊(I)。
4.如權(quán)利要求3所述的自動(dòng)化軟件接收測(cè)試方法,其特征在于,所述的步驟2中升級(jí)軟件版本完成后需對(duì)電子設(shè)備重啟。
5.如權(quán)利要求3所述的自動(dòng)化軟件接收測(cè)試方法,其特征在于,所述的測(cè)試內(nèi)容包含軟件升級(jí)、LED燈檢測(cè)、快速向?qū)暇W(wǎng)配置、快速向?qū)o線功能配置、設(shè)備恢復(fù)出廠值、導(dǎo)入配置及導(dǎo)出配置。
6.如權(quán)利要求3所述的自動(dòng)化軟件接收測(cè)試方法,其特征在于,所述的步驟S2中若電子設(shè)備的硬件信息不完備則結(jié)束自動(dòng)化軟件接收測(cè)試。
7.如權(quán)利要求3所述的自動(dòng)化軟件接收測(cè)試方法,其特征在于,所述的步驟b中的讀取配置信息包含讀取撥號(hào)信息、無線名稱、無線密碼信息、設(shè)備配置導(dǎo)入信息、設(shè)備初始信息。
8.如權(quán)利要求3所述的自動(dòng)化軟件接收測(cè)試方法,其特征在于,所述的步驟c中的測(cè)試結(jié)論包含軟件升級(jí)成功、LED燈顯示正常、快速向?qū)暇W(wǎng)配置正常保存、快速向?qū)o線配置正常保存、電子設(shè)備正常上網(wǎng)。
【文檔編號(hào)】G06F11/36GK103778060SQ201410017826
【公開日】2014年5月7日 申請(qǐng)日期:2014年1月15日 優(yōu)先權(quán)日:2014年1月15日
【發(fā)明者】王曉倩, 嚴(yán)敏 申請(qǐng)人:上海斐訊數(shù)據(jù)通信技術(shù)有限公司